Transaction df32a7ffd8dcebd3918e207cbd018a21ec7a387b25cfb3db58899f58c5da399b
1 Input
2 Outputs
- df32a7ffd8dcebd3918e207cbd018a21ec7a387b25cfb3db58899f58c5da399b:0
- df32a7ffd8dcebd3918e207cbd018a21ec7a387b25cfb3db58899f58c5da399b:1
value 9642
address 32iK97819qZckHiSPEab7zBHSjDJP28gAS
value 709223
address 17Ah5honJdRL4vfezabTbq6TAE7vKhkaoy